What is a motor nameplate?

The nameplate defines a motor’s basic mechanical design, electrical performance and dimensional parameters. NEMA requires specific data to be included on the nameplate, but manufacturers may choose to include other information to assist in the installation, operation and maintenance of custom motors or those manufactured for specific purposes.

What is an MVS POW-R-drive motor-operated switch?

An MVS Pow-R-Drive motor-operated switch is a standard, manually operated switch in combination with a heavy-duty electric motor-driven linear actuator that charges the spring. The linear actuator is located in a separate isolated low voltage compartment.

What are the IEC and NEMA requirements for a nameplate?

Table 1 has the requirements for IEC and NEMA for AC and DC name-plates. As mentioned before, there are other specifications for specific motor designs. These requirements do not limit what can be included on the nameplate. For instance, many manufacturers include bearing no-menclature.
